An ocean bill of lading is a document required for the transportation of goods overseas across international waters.
An ocean bill of lading is a document that allows goods to be transported across international waters. This document serves as the contract between the shipper and carrier and ensures that the exporter is paid and the importer receives their product. It proves the existence of a goods transportation contract.
The ocean bill of lading contains information on the type of goods, weight, quantity, and location of the goods. The bill of lading acts as evidence of a contract of carriage between the shipper and the shipping line to carry out the transportation of cargo under the terms and conditions agreed upon between the seller and buyer.
